Hey all I've been a Honda owner for all my life. I had a RHD Civic Type R 10 years ago but have since been taking it easy and got out of the car scene.

But now I'm back with my 1972 Honda 600 Coupe.

Follow along and watch this car come back to life. I found this car in Portland, OR from a guy who bought it in december from the original owner. It has been in dry indoor storage since 1980 and hasn't seen the road since.

It has all original paint currently and is very clean. Its currently at a micro car specialty shop being worked on before coming back to Milwaukee to begin its new life.

i was able to get my Z600 on the road for about 100 miles a few weeks ago. was absolutely amazing but it didn't last long. the block and head threads for the cooling fan ripped out beyond repair unless welded so i had a spare head and block i had sent out to be freshened up. I've decided that since its this far apart now I'm gonna strip the entire chassis down and sandblast and paint everything so the entire underside is as new looking as possible. I'm planning on keeping it all original body paint.

Heres an update on the Z600.

The engine got rebuilt over the summer and is running pretty well, it still needs a little tuning to get all the power from the 36hp engine.

I rebuilt the entire rear end. I had everything sandblasted and powder coated and it looks like new. All new brakes, wheel cylinders and rear shocks.

I also pressure washed the entire engine bay, wheel wells and under carriage. 30 years of dust and grime to wash away. I had the entire underside undercoated while all the suspension was removed.

The exhaust system all the way from the header to the tail pipe has been ceramic coated, all of the front suspension items were powder coated along with the subframe. looks like new.

Ive also installed new carpet in the front of the car but left the original stuff in the rear because its still in ok shape. will most likely replace it before spring though.

don't have much time to work on it currently but its being kept warm and dry.

Between these sites you should pretty much be able to find everything you need. I also have a large stockpile or parts feel free to email me and ill help you out with any questions.

http://www.honda600shop.com/index.php. - mike oconnor runs this site and has more than what's actually listed. He did the machine work on my engine turned out amazing.

http://www.honda600carparts.com/. The person who runs this site is Bruce I've purchased many parts from him and have been very pleased!! Some stuff is a little pricey, if you have any questions on his parts or prices let me know and I can tell u if its available elsewhere for a better deal. But all in all it's a great one stop shop for picking up just about everything you need to rebuild your car. And best part is its free shipping on everything!!

Z600miles@comcast.net - miles is an amazing guy and has been working on these cars for decades. He's super friendly and has no problem handing out his phone number and will talk to you over the phone if you get stuck on a project. He also has many parts and also lists on eBay on his store. He has a stockpile way larger than what he has listed just ask and if he doesn't have it will point you in the right direction.

There are also 2 Honda 600 groups on yahoo.com they are full of owners who and help troubleshoot and give advise. The backlog of questions and posts is amazing and will help you with just about any issue that arrises. i personally like the "2cylinder" one better than the "anz" page.
